The current timeline for the commissioning of the new Tygerberg Central Hospital is in the 2033/34 financial year, says Western Cape Department of Health and Wellness Tygerberg Hospital public-private partnership (PPP) project officer Klaas Langenhoven.

The long-delayed project to build the new facility was first announced in 2009.

The existing Tygerberg Hospital opened its doors in 1976.

The new facility will be located on the same site as the current hospital, on the western side of the campus.

Langenhoven says the 893-bed facility received TA1 approval – the first in a string of approvals required – from the National Treasury in November 2022.
